Ingredient Notes
Please check the recipe card below for a detailed, printable ingredient list.
PASTA – The pasta serves as the base of the salad, providing a hearty texture and absorbing the flavorful dressing. Use your preferred shortcut pasta, such as penne, fusilli, elbow macaroni, or rotini pasta. For a fun twist, you try using spinach pasta or gluten-free pasta.
BACON – The bacon adds a smoky flavor and a crunchy texture that contrasts nicely with the other ingredients.
TOMATOES – Cherry or grape tomatoes are great choices for this pasta salad. I recommend halving them.
PEAS – You can use fresh or frozen peas.
OLIVES – A half cup of sliced black olives adds savory flavor, more texture, and visual appeal.
CHEESE – The cheese adds a creamy texture and a rich flavor, complementing the savory bacon and dressing. Cheddar is perfect for this pasta salad. You can use shredded Cheddar or cube the cheese according to your preferences.
RANCH – The creamy ranch seasoning ties all the ingredients together, adding a tangy and savory flavor to the salad. I prefer the combination I describe in this recipe. But if you want to save time, you can also use store-bought Ranch salad dressing.
How To Make Bacon Ranch Pasta Salad
Please check the printable recipe card below for more detailed instructions.
- Prepare the pasta in a large pot al dente according to the package directions.
- Cook the bacon in the oven for 18 minutes at 400° Fahrenheit.
- Combine the dressing mix, milk, sour cream, and mayonnaise in a small bowl and whisk until well combined.
- Use a large bowl to combine bacon, peas, tomatoes, olives, and cheese, and add the chilled pasta.
- Add the dressing to the pasta salad and toss to coat.
Leftovers
STORE – You can keep this salad for 3 to 5 days in the fridge. Store the leftovers in an airtight container. Give the salad a good stir before serving.

Bacon Ranch Pasta Salad
Ingredients
- 1 pound cooked pasta fusilli, orecchiette, elbow, macaroni
- 12 ounces bacon cooked, chopped
- 1 cup peas defrosted
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es halved
- ½ cup black olives sliced
- 4 ounces Cheddar cheese shredded
DRESSING
- ½ cup mayonnaise
- ½ cup sour cream
- ½ cup milk
- 1 packet dry Ranch Dressing Mix
Instructions
PREP WORK
- Preheat the oven to 400° Fahrenheit and cook the bacon for 18 minutes. Once cooked, pat dry the bacon and chop into bite-sized pieces.
- Cook the pasta according to the package instructions. Chill with cold water and set aside.
RANCH DRESSING
- Combine dry Ranch dressing dip, mayonnaise, sour cream, and milk and whisk until well combined.
PUTTING THE SALAD TOGETHER
- Combine pasta, peas, tomatoes, olives, bacon, and cheddar cheese in a large salad bowl. Add the dressing and combine well.
